A DRIVER has been arrested following a two-vehicle crash near Stroud yesterday.
Police were called at 4.45pm yesterday, Thursday, following a report of a two-vehicle crash at Walls Quarry, Brimscombe, near Stroud.
A spokesperson said: "The driver of one of the cars was arrested on suspicion of driving while under the influence of alcohol and has been taken to hospital for treatment.
"The road was closed to allow for recovery of the cars and later reopened."
